  • Beading History

    Beading has been partners with fiber since the first of humankind pulled a piece of vine from a plant, picked up a rock, shell or seed with a natural perforation, and strung the vine through the perforated object to tie around her/his neck and wear. It does not matter whether that person wore the object as personal adornment, to imbue her/him with powers or for other symbolic reasons; this was the beginning of bead stringing and bead and fiber’s history together. Bead Stringing is where beading began.

  • The BeadWorkers Guild
    The Beadworkers Guild was formed in 1999 and is now a Registered Charity with a membership of over 3000. It is a focus for everyone who enjoys beading and learning about beadwork, where the emphasis is on individual creativity, and the sharing of ideas and techniques. The main aims of the Guild are to facilitate the exchange of ideas and knowledge amongst beadworkers and to promote beadwork to the public at large.
